Key Themes Shaping Tamil Theatre Today
Speedy Summary
- Tamil theater and Chennai’s evolution over the last century reflect social and cultural shifts in the region.
- The modern era of Tamil theatre started in the 1860s with Thiruvottiyur Kasiviswanatha Mudaliar’s Dumbachary Vilasam. Pammal Sambandha Mudaliyar later popularised realistic acting and prose plays, founding Suguna Vilasa Sabha in 1891.
- Past landmarks include Victoria Public hall and Othavadai Theatre, hosting influential figures like T.K.S. Brothers, M.R. Radha, N.S. Krishnan, and more.
- Feminist figure Balamani Ammal pioneered women-led theatre companies in early 20th-century Tamil Nadu with adaptations like Rajambal.
- Political narratives entered Tamil theatre thru stalwarts such as C.N. Annadurai and M.Karunanidhi during the Dravidian movement era starting mid-century.
